I will test builds better next time. > > My mail client is broken now, so I cannot respond to your letter (I can only > read mail via SF for now). > > 1) I defined FB_SIZE_T in types_pub because when somebody (Vlad?) ported my > code into Firebird he > made Trace API use size_t quantities in public interfaces. I used > ntrace_size_t (defined as > "unsigned int"). > > This type can become private as soon Trace API uses unsigned int.
If nobody objects I will do this change. > 2) Re loop counters: In counter-based loops the best and fastest datatype is > "int". It is obviously > faster than "unsigned int"/ULONG/FB_SIZE_T, whatever. You can use the latter > interchangeably, and > this is appropriate for current code base. Why is 'int' faster than 'unsigned'? > Unfortunately we have to interface with large amounts of code that uses > "unsigned" for sizes and > signed/unsigned comparisons are not very good thing because of a flaw that > got introduced into C > standard during ANSI standardization process. Signed gets promoted to > unsigned and not vice versa > (and how early C compilers did). So using plain "int" while attractive, is > not very appropriate. > > Thank you, > > Nikolay > > ------------------------------------------------------------------------------ > Want fast and easy access to all the code in your enterprise?
